HIGH SPEED USB HOST CONTROL
click start control panel administrive tools ,computer management ,device manager scroll down universal serial bus controllers you should see a yellow question mark?
right click to reinstall drivers or
if you can see your usb drive but its not working
ports(com&lpt)right click update driver
check the USB leads that attach to the motherboard usually red-white-green-black make sure they are securely seated and have no dust build up on them dust will cause static and a lot of unforeseen problems for a computer and its parts also
scroll to disk drives if you can see your drive + to expand right click you should see options to update driver,disable,uninstall scan for hardware changes. or
select properties you should see options in the general tab to troubleshoot,policies,volumes,driver and details under the driver tab you will have the options to check the driver details,update driver,rollback driver or uninstall then

Failure in saving BIOs
I have
Enter BIOS SETUP.
Choose Load Factory Defaults.
Save/Exit.
Or, since the motherboard is less than one week old, it has a warranty. Exercise the warranty, to get a replacement motherboard.
